Color Conversions
| Format | Value | CSS Usage | |
|---|---|---|---|
| HSL | hsl(229, 99%, 58%) | color: hsl(229, 99%, 58%) | |
| HEX | #2A51FE | color: #2A51FE | |
| RGB | rgb(42, 81, 254) | color: rgb(42, 81, 254) | |
| CMYK | cmyk(83%, 68%, 0%, 0%) | — | |
| HSV | hsv(229, 83%, 100%) | — | |
| HWB | hwb(229 17% 0%) | color: hwb(229 17% 0%) | |
| OKLCH | oklch(0.533 0.2573 266.45) | color: oklch(0.533 0.2573 266.45) | |
| Lab | lab(43.55 49.28 -88.58) | color: lab(43.55 49.28 -88.58) | |
| LCH | lch(43.55 101.37 299.09) | color: lch(43.55 101.37 299.09) |

What colors go well with #2A51FE?
The complementary color is HSL(49, 99%, 58%). For a triadic harmony, use hues 229°, 349°, and 109°. For analogous combinations, try hues 199° and 259°. See the Color Harmony section above for complete palettes with previews.
